About Amazon
Amazon has grown from an online bookstore into one of the
world's largest technology companies. Through Amazon Web Services (AWS), the
company provides cloud computing infrastructure used by startups, enterprises,
educational institutions, and governments across the globe.
AWS continues to invest heavily in artificial intelligence
and machine learning technologies. One of its major AI offerings is Amazon
Bedrock, a platform that enables developers to build and deploy generative AI
applications using multiple foundation models through a unified interface.
The company is known for encouraging innovation,
customer-focused thinking, continuous learning, and data-driven
decision-making. Employees frequently work on products that serve millions of
users while collaborating with experts across engineering, research, design,
and business teams.
Key Responsibilities
The UX Designer will contribute throughout the complete
product design lifecycle, including research, concept development, testing, and
implementation.
Major responsibilities include:
- Design
intuitive user interfaces for AI-powered developer tools.
- Create
wireframes, user flows, mockups, and interactive prototypes.
- Simplify
highly technical AI and machine learning concepts into user-friendly
experiences.
- Conduct
usability testing and analyze research findings to improve product
usability.
- Collaborate
with software engineers to ensure accurate implementation of design
specifications.
- Partner
with product managers to prioritize customer needs and product goals.
- Develop
dashboards and visualization experiences for AI inference metrics and
performance.
- Improve
prompt optimization workflows through thoughtful interface design.
- Maintain
consistency using shared design systems and reusable components.
- Participate
in design reviews and incorporate constructive feedback.
- Stay
updated with emerging AI-assisted design tools and modern UX practices.
- Support
continuous improvement through iterative design and customer feedback.
